Multi Ways Holdings Ltd., a leading supplier of heavy construction equipment in Singapore, announced on May 29, 2025, that it has regained compliance with the New York Stock Exchange $(NYSE)$ continued listing standards. The company had previously fallen out of compliance due to the late filing of its Annual Report on Form 20-F for the fiscal year ending December 31, 2024. Upon filing the report on May 23, 2025, the NYSE Regulation confirmed on May 27, 2025, that the company met the necessary requirements to maintain its listing on the NYSE American exchange.
